Company Overview
BMO Capital Markets is a leading, full-service financial services provider offering corporate and investment banking, treasury management, research and advisory services, and more to clients around the world. BMO Capital Markets has approximately 2,700 professionals in 33 locations around the world.
The Equity Research department covers over 925 stocks across diverse sectors and provides equity strategy, quantitative analysis, and portfolio management services. The U.S. Equity Research department consists of 34 analysts and approximately 50 associates, covering over 600 stocks.
Role Summary
We are seeking an Equity Research Associate to join our U.S. Real Estate/REITs team. The associate will work closely with the senior analyst to develop and market equity research products. The role requires strong analytical and critical thinking skills, a passion for the stock market, keen attention to detail, and a strong work ethic.
The work environment emphasizes collaboration, coordination, and a shared knowledge base, while also valuing independence, initiative, idea generation, and ownership.
Ideal Candidate
Our ideal candidate has 1–2 years of equity research or real estate finance experience, is fully licensed, and is interested in joining an established REIT team with coverage of over 80 companies. Strong accounting and finance skills, a passion for real estate and the stock market, and the ability to work on a fast-paced equity research team are critical.

Responsibilities
- Build and maintain detailed company models (IS/BS/CF)
- Analyze financial statements and news related to industry coverage
- Conduct store and channel checks
- Write equity research reports and, over time, formulate investment theses
- Participate in site visits and management meetings
- Maintain and analyze industry data
- Communicate investment recommendations to internal and external clients
- Collaborate on tools and processes to gather industry and company-related news for one-off products or integration into regular research
- Help establish industry, regulatory, and political relationships to better predict and/or handicap industry trends and company-related events

Experience & Skills
A combination of exceptional writing skills, technical knowledge, and skills in equity research, finance, or accounting—demonstrated through relevant work and educational experience—is required. Prior industry experience in U.S. Real Estate/REITs is not required but could be a benefit. Candidates must have a clear and proven track record of achievement throughout their education and career.
Other necessary attributes include:
- Exceptional written and verbal communication skills
- Strong organizational skills and comfort managing various priorities
- Client service mindset and ability to prioritize client needs with accuracy
- Ability to interact professionally with company management teams and clients (analysts and portfolio managers)
- A keen interest in and demonstrated understanding of Equity Research
- Positive attitude, intellectual curiosity, ability to learn quickly, and strong attention to detail
- Superior work ethic; self-motivated; able to work collaboratively as well as independently
- Ability to systematically manage a heavy workload and meet stringent deadlines
- Flexibility to work irregular and extended hours
- Solid technology skills with robust knowledge of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Bloomberg and/or FactSet
- Demonstrated use of AI in the workplace
- CFA Charter or working towards the CFA designation is a plus

Education
A bachelor’s degree is required. A post-secondary degree in a related field of study is a plus. U.S. only.
Compensation
Equity Research Associate Salary Range: $110,000 up to $140,000 USD (subject to meeting specific skills, experience, education, and qualification requirements)
Senior Research Associate Salary Range: $150,000 up to $180,000 USD (subject to meeting specific skills, experience, education, and qualification requirements)
Pay Type: Salaried
The above represents BMO Financial Group’s pay range and type. Salaries may vary based on factors such as location, skills, experience, education, and qualifications, and may include a commission structure. For commission roles, the salary listed represents BMO Financial Group’s expected target for the first year in this position.
BMO Financial Group’s total compensation package varies by pay type and may include performance-based incentives and discretionary bonuses, as well as other perks and rewards. BMO also offers health insurance, tuition reimbursement, accident and life insurance, and retirement savings plans.
